Ok I need to know how to simplify Thanks <br><br> Dimitri
aliina [53]

ex: 5/25=1/5

5 divided by 5 is and 25 divided by 5 is 5.

1.Write down the factors for the numerator(top number) and the denominator(the number down below).

2.Find the largest factor that is common between the two.

3.Divide the numerator and denominator by the greatest common factor.

4.Write down the reduced fraction.
